### Step 6: Recreate the Lag Alarm

Before promoting the Kestrelbase replica, the read-replica lag alarm must be recreated in the new Veldt region, since alarms do not migrate automatically. Verify the alarm fires on the test replica before proceeding to Step 7. Apply exactly the following configuration values for the alarm.

deployment values, tafof-taduf:
pelius:
  pin: 6508
  tenant: praiel
  seal: seal_4e33a2f4
  metrics_host: metrics.pelius.plorvagrid.corp
  standby_team: druix
  escalation: juldor-norius
  nonce: 5db598

Alert: ExportRetryBacklog (Trellick Reports)

This fires when failed report exports have retried more than five times within an hour. Usually it means the downstream archive at the Morvane cluster is slow or rejecting uploads. Exports are safe to re-queue; no data is lost. Before escalating, check queue depth and recent deploys. The retry procedure is documented on the internal page below.

operations page: https://jira.qorvelsys.internal/browse/pages/browse/pages

## Harrowfield Telemetry Gateway — Ingest Stall

If tractor telemetry stops flowing from the field units, first confirm the gateway process is healthy on the ingest hosts, then check that the MQTT broker shows active sessions. Most stalls are caused by the dedupe table filling its partition; verify partition counts before restarting anything. To inspect the dedupe table and recent ingest rows, connect with the connection string below.

primary connection of yagep-kahip = redis://giliel_svc:zYiKsLL2PLpfPL@db-348f.xolmarsys.corp:5432/fenwyn

## Changelog — Frameforge Transcode Farm v4.12.1

Rotated the worker signing key used by the Frameforge transcode farm following the quarterly security review. All encoder nodes in the Veltmere cluster have been drained, re-registered, and verified against the new key. Jobs submitted during the rotation window were queued and replayed with no loss. Old key material is revoked effective this release; any node still presenting it will be rejected at enrollment. The new deploy key for the farm is published below.

deploy key for tahof-yadup: bky6_JWeaJq